Shiva tattoos are at the heart of tattoo culture in India. We get countless requests for Shiva tattoos from men and women of all age groups. At Black Pearl Ink, we have made our fair share of Shiva, trishul and rudraksha related tattoos. Here is a gallery of few of them with some background stories. This is a Shiva tattoo which is half shaded and half coloured. The client is a devotee of lord Shiva and wanted a Shiva tattoo on his chest with a lotus and trident. He was following up with us for almost two years to get this tattoo done but due to various reasons he had to keep postponing. Finally our stars aligned and we started the work with him. We have heavily customized this tattoo where we have used Mandala and other abstract styles in red and black colours and a lotus flower in blue colour. Initially we wanted to add the Mahamrityunjaya mantra above this tattoo but the space was not enough for the complete mantra so we used a mandala there as a filler. This tattoo was completed in two sittings. In the first sitting the grey shaded Shiva tattoo was made and in the second one the coloured lotus, trident and mandala was done. The Shiva tattoo is made by Swapnil and the colour, shades and the mandala parts are done by other artist Kiran.
